2007 Opel Vivaro vs. 2005 Renault Twingo

To start off, 2007 Opel Vivaro is newer by 2 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2005 Renault Twingo.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2005 Renault Twingo would be higher. At 1,870 cc (4 cylinders), 2007 Opel Vivaro is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2007 Opel Vivaro (100 HP @ 3500 RPM) has 41 more horse power than 2005 Renault Twingo. (59 HP @ 5250 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2007 Opel Vivaro should accelerate faster than 2005 Renault Twingo.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2007 Opel Vivaro weights approximately 782 kg more than 2005 Renault Twingo.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2007 Opel Vivaro (240 Nm @ 2000 RPM) has 147 more torque (in Nm) than 2005 Renault Twingo. (93 Nm @ 2500 RPM). This means 2007 Opel Vivaro will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2005 Renault Twingo.
